Most privacy advice misses the point

Settings live inside the device. Updates can roll them back. Apps can override them. A toggle you flipped last month can quietly reset after an upgrade. You are trusting a system designed to collect data to stop collecting data.

Meanwhile, the risks are not hypothetical. They are running in the background right now.

  • Location tracking. Apps and ad networks log your movements and sell that history to data brokers.

  • Wireless skimming. Thieves read RFID and NFC chips in your cards and passport from inches away, in a crowd, without touching you.

  • Relay attacks. Criminals amplify your car key fob signal to unlock and drive off, often in under a minute.

  • Remote access. A connected device is a reachable device. Connection is the doorway every attacker needs.

  • Data harvesting. Your habits, contacts, and patterns get packaged into a profile that follows you across the internet.

Airplane mode does not close these doors. It dims the screen and keeps the radios alive enough to leak. Locking your phone and trusting your settings is like locking your front door and leaving the windows open.

The fix lives in hardware, not settings

A Faraday bag is a physical shield. It surrounds your device in conductive material that blocks every wireless signal: cellular, WiFi, Bluetooth, GPS, RFID, and NFC. Put your phone inside and it goes dark. Nothing in, nothing out. No tracking, no skimming, no remote access, because there is no signal to exploit.

This is not software. There is nothing to toggle, update, or trust. The protection is the material itself.

The principle is old and proven. A conductive enclosure that blocks electromagnetic fields is a Faraday cage, and the physics has held up since the 1800s. What is new is how much you need it.

One honest limit, stated plainly: a Faraday bag blocks signals, not sound. It does not turn off your microphone, because the mic is built into the device. If you want the mic truly silent, the phone goes in the bag. Inside, it cannot transmit anything it hears.
